Betty and the Buccaneers (1917)

Betty and the Buccaneers (1917) poster

Romantic adventure film in which the girl Betty, who dreams about pirates, and her gullible father is tricked by a set of real pirates. They are rescued by a young man who has a crush on Betty.

Director: Rollin S. Sturgeon
Runtime: 62 min
